Currently, most studies on automatic metro train driving rely on actual driving curves and data, but its acquisition is often complicated and costly, and is relatively homogeneous and less versatile. Therefore, this paper proposes an automatic generation method for large virtual driving curves of metro trains. It can be concluded from the generation of large virtual driving curves: (1) The proposed method can generate large virtual curves according to different and complex line conditions, and the curves generated provides more driving options for train driving; (2) The curves generated covers all possible station travel times and large driving curves are available for screening within each time period; (3) The curves generated are both highly accurate and diverse, which can generate large datasets for supervised learning of automatic train driving under complex line conditions.
